Photography Contest Tips: No to Mergers

Have you seen a picture with its subject looking really weird? Those kinds of pictures where there are unwanted connections? Those are what we call mergers. Yes, in photography composition, avoiding mergers is a fundamental technique. You can’t surely win a photography contest with mergers on your entries, right? For beginners, mergers are elements in the background that could merge into the foreground of the subject of interest which can cause undesirable output. It’s like taking a photo of your friend with a tree behind its back and you were too focused on the subject and didn’t notice that you were capturing the tree located just above your friend’s head. It turns out like the tree branches are directly connected from the head. Mergers are too common for those who are beginning to learn photography which is why it is very important to learn how to avoid mergers and do a lot of practice. There is lot of examples of photographs displaying mergers in the web and even in some photography contest online for beginners. Even in some photo contest, there are still near mergers found in numerous entries. Near mergers are lines and objects that are too close on the subject of interest. 



According to expert photographers who have already won numerous photo contest and competitions for years, the number one technique in avoiding mergers is to determine the right angle to shoot. If you need to bend down a little bit or move to the right, then do it! When you capture your subject, do not focus on the subject only but also on its background. Impact of Lines In Producing Excellent Photography Composition

Composition in photography is very important for the picture to look meaningful and catchy. It’s one of the most vital criteria used in any kind of photo contest. It is in the composition of a photograph where judges and critics from photography contest sees the impact of the image. Having an excellent composition in the photo could surely make an entry competitive in a photography contest no matter what.

One element of photography composition is the lines. It greatly affects how the viewer sees the image. Great lines mean dynamic photograph. If you have plans to join a photo contest, you must learn the effect of the different lines in the photograph.

Vertical lines can be found in trees, people standing up, buildings and other infrastructures. This kind of lines motivates moods and feeling of strength, superiority, height, and power. If you have the desire to display these kinds of feelings in your photo contest entry, then make sure to let the vertical lines be distinctive in the photo. If you want to use buildings as the subject for your picture contest entry, make sure to make the vertical lines clearly visible. Next are horizontal lines which can be commonly found in landscapes. Take note how important is the horizontal lines in the rules of thirds which is another element of photography composition. Horizontal lines stimulate the mood of peacefulness and feeling of tranquility. Picture contest entries that concern about landscapes can be enhanced through proper positioning of the lines.

Then, there are diagonal lines which simply denote force. This can be applied to photograph where in the photographer wants to display an act. Diagonal lines can be seen in sports photography and trees moved by air. There are also times that a photographer needs to tilt the camera to force a diagonal line; however, this technique must be used properly that it should look natural especially if you are making an entry in a photography contest. Curve lines show the most artistic type of lines. The “S” curve line which is commonly known as the line of beauty can be seen in roads, double curves of rivers. A lot of experienced photographers who join a photo contest used “S” curve lines to display the natural beauty of nature.

Understanding the effects and uses of different lines in photography could produce a photo that is natural, dynamic, and making a great impact to the viewers. Proper use of lines could indeed make a difference in the photo’s composition.

Guide in Using the Rule of Thirds For A Photo Contest Entry

Some people are under the impression that putting their subject at the center makes a good photo which is not always right. It would be redundant if that’s always the case. In most photo contest, different angles are taken into account by the judges. A photograph is somewhat considered as a different mode of telling a story which can be defined as the connection of thoughts written in paragraphs. The same concept applies to photography. Photography isn’t all about the subject but its how the elements in the photo complement each other. It’s the balance of composition in the photograph that catches the viewer’s attention. If you have plans joining a photography contest, you have to learn the proper way of exposing a balanced composition to impress the judges.
 

Photo Contest: The Rule of Thirds


img source: photographymad.com
One of the basics of photography composition is the famous Rule of thirds which could be mistakenly be taken as rule of ninths because it generates 9 rectangles. Anyway, Rule of thirds is very popular that you can almost see it in most entries in a picture contest. Rule of thirds is very helpful for beginners who want to learn about photography and eventually wishes to win a photo contest; however, it would be hard for them to accept it at first. Most beginners who join a picture contest would always consider a center stage for their subject or focal point. Rule of thirds is a rule of thumb in photography which states that a photo should be visualized to be divided into thirds which makes nine equal sections. It includes point of intersections that will generate potential interest to the viewers. A landscape piece in a photo contest strongly applies rule of thirds because horizons are defined. Experts always advised that if you choose a landscape as your subject upon joining a picture contest, it is vital to consider the location of the area of interest of the photo. Let’s say that the area of interest of your entry in a photography contest is the plane section like water or land, the horizon line needs to be at least one third from the top line; if the area of interests is the sky, then the horizon line must be placed two thirds from the top line. By doing so, the photo could display a strong vibe and energy.

Using Rule of thirds in photography or in any kind of photography contest helps photographers in guiding viewers where to look at. Distinct spots will be highlighted when Rule of thirds is used correctly.
